The 2020 Teen Action Fair theme is In Community We Flourish. The theme was chosen by the Gates Foundation Discovery Center Youth Ambassadors to highlight the importance of community-driven social movements and the value of human connection and fellowship.
Celebrate youth-driven change at Teen Action Fair. Connect with youth and organizations working to make a difference in their local and global communities through volunteering, art, social justice campaigns, and more.
